Leadership Overview

Communication Service for the Deaf has 5 executives leading key functions including financial strategy, legal compliance, ASL communication services, administrative operations, and regional connectivity programs.

Dedicated to empowering the deaf and hard of hearing community, Communication Service for the Deaf advances social impact through innovative technology and essential resources. This organization fosters global accessibility by bridging communication gaps.

Leadership Roles at Communication Service for the Deaf

  • Chief Financial Officer - Thomas Means
  • Division President of ASL Now - Greg Pollock
  • Division President of California Connect - Amanda Whyrick
  • Chief Legal Officer - Maria Wilson
  • Chief Administrative Officer (CAO) - Elizabeth Stone
